High power, low-noise, and multiply resonant photodetector for interferometric gravitational wave detectors

Abstract:
We have developed a new photodetector circuit for use in interferometric gravitational wave detectors. The circuit can detect high laser power with low noise and provide multiple outputs for different signal frequencies. The dynamic range of this circuit is increased in comparison with the photodetector design used until the end of 2005.
